renderer: reserved colorspace option in target api

API Modification:
- Result WgCanvas::target(void* device, void* instance, void* target, uint32_t w, uint32_t h, int type = 0)
 -> Result WgCanvas::target(void* device, void* instance, void* target, uint32_t w, uint32_t h, ColorSpace cs, int type = 0)
- Tvg_Result tvg_wgcanvas_set_target(Tvg_Canvas* canvas, void* device, void* instance, void* target, uint32_t w, uint32_t h, int type)
 -> Tvg_Result tvg_wgcanvas_set_target(Tvg_Canvas* canvas, void* device, void* instance, void* target, uint32_t w, uint32_t h, Tvg_Colorspace cs, int type)
